@TheALLTELDodge12, NASCAR instituted the double yellow line rule for a reason. It gets really slick below the apron via the yellow line, and cars could just come up the race track right into the field, as well as allowing wrecks to occur. Darrell Waltrip said that I believe. Daytona and Talladega are plate tracks meaning the cars are in bunched up packs, and the speeds are high all across the track, mostly without using the brakes.
